PURPOSE: The study hypothesized that the addition of lateral extra-articular tenodesis (LEAT) in anterior cruciate ligament reconstruction (ACLR) had a significant effect on ACL graft healing. METHODS: A total of 80 patients were divided into two cohorts matched for gender, age, body mass index, time from surgery to post-operative MRI and graft diameter. Forty patients underwent ACL reconstruction alone, while 40 underwent ACLR in addition to LEAT. Patients underwent a magnetic resonance imaging scan at 12 months post-surgery; tunnel apertures were measured using multiplanar reformation, graft healing was assessed using signal-to-noise quotient (SNQ) in three regions of interest and finally graft maturity and integration were classified using the Howell and Ge scale, respectively. In addition, clinical evaluation and patient-reported outcome measures were collected. RESULTS: The mean femoral tunnel widening at 12 months post-surgery was 39.8 ± 14.0% in the ACLR + LEAT group and 55.2 ± 12.7% in the ACLR alone group (p < 0.05). The mean tibial tunnel widening was 29.3 ± 12.7% in the ACLR + LEAT group and 44.4 ± 12.1% in the ACLR group (p < 0.05). The mean adjusted graft SNQ was 9.0 ± 14.9 in the ACLR + LEAT group and 9.5 ± 11.4 in the ACLR group (n.s.). CONCLUSION: At 1 year post-operatively, we noted significantly less femoral and tibial tunnel widening in the ACLR + LEAT group. LEAT did not result in a statistically significant effect on graft healing. LEVEL OF EVIDENCE: Level III.

Control of mRNA translation is a crucial regulatory mechanism used by bacteria to respond to their environment. In the soil bacterium Pseudomonas fluorescens, RimK modifies the C-terminus of ribosomal protein RpsF to influence important aspects of rhizosphere colonisation through proteome remodelling. In this study, we show that RimK activity is itself under complex, multifactorial control by the co-transcribed phosphodiesterase trigger enzyme (RimA) and a polyglutamate-specific protease (RimB). Furthermore, biochemical experimentation and mathematical modelling reveal a role for the nucleotide second messenger cyclic-di-GMP in coordinating these activities. Active ribosome regulation by RimK occurs by two main routes: indirectly, through changes in the abundance of the global translational regulator Hfq and directly, with translation of surface attachment factors, amino acid transporters and key secreted molecules linked specifically to RpsF modification. Our findings show that post-translational ribosomal modification functions as a rapid-response mechanism that tunes global gene translation in response to environmental signals.

Prior to infection, phytopathogenic bacteria face a challenging environment on the plant surface, where they are exposed to nutrient starvation and abiotic stresses. Pathways enabling surface adhesion, stress tolerance, and epiphytic survival are important for successful plant pathogenesis. Understanding the roles and regulation of these pathways is therefore crucial to fully understand bacterial plant infections. The phytopathogen Pseudomonas syringae pv. tomato (Pst) encodes multiple polysaccharides that are implicated in biofilm formation, stress survival, and virulence in other microbes. To examine how these polysaccharides impact Pst epiphytic survival and pathogenesis, we analysed mutants in multiple polysaccharide loci to determine their intersecting contributions to epiphytic survival and infection. In parallel, we used qRT-PCR to analyse the regulation of each pathway. Pst polysaccharides are tightly coordinated by multiple environmental signals. Nutrient availability, temperature, and surface association strongly affect the expression of different polysaccharides under the control of the signalling protein genes ladS and cbrB and the second messenger cyclic-di-GMP. Furthermore, functionally redundant, combinatorial phenotypes were observed for several polysaccharides. Exopolysaccharides play a role in mediating leaf adhesion, while α-glucan and alginate together confer desiccation tolerance. Our results suggest that polysaccharides play important roles in overcoming environmental challenges to Pst during plant infection.

The development of active electrocatalysts and photocatalysts for hydrogen evolution reaction (HER) and for environmental remediation is a huge challenge. Research is still underway on the development of low-cost catalytic materials with appreciable efficiency for HER. In the present study, a composite of metal organic framework (MOF) with CdS and graphene (NH2-MIL-125(Ti)/CdS-graphene) composites were developed with different loadings of graphene material via solvothermal technique. Further the electrocatalytic activity of the synthesized catalysts were investigated for HER and photocatalytic degradation of dye. Results show that the synthesized catalyst with a less amount of graphene was more active. HER results showed a less Tafel slope of 70.8 and 61.9 mVdec-1 with 15.6 mA/cm2 and 15.46 mA/cm2 current densities under light on and off conditions. Further the dye degradation activity of the synthesized catalysts was tested with Rhodamine B dye and results showed that the catalyst showed excellent activity for low weight loading of graphene with a degradation efficiency of 95 % and followed pseudo first order kinetic model. Overall results showed that the synthesized composites are promising for HER and photocatalytic applications.

Gabapentin is approved to treat postherpetic neuralgia and epilepsy with partial-onset seizures. The large majority of gabapentin prescribing is off label. Gabapentin may be abused for euphoria, potentiating the high from opiates, reduction of alcohol cravings, a cocaine-like high, as well as sedation or sleep. Individuals at the highest risk for abusing gabapentin include those with opioid abuse, mental illness, or previous history of prescription drug abuse. States are now taking action to track gabapentin use through prescription monitoring programs, and some states have reclassified it as a Schedule V controlled substance. This commentary summarizes gabapentin's abuse potential, identifies state-level actions regarding gabapentin monitoring, and discusses possible clinical implications and ways to enhance patient safety when prescribing gabapentin.

PURPOSE: The rapidly growing and emerging nature of biologics have made indications for regenerative and reparative hip therapies ever changing, with at times only early-stage evidence for their use. The purpose of this study was to review and summarize the currently available data on the management of hip cartilage injuries and osteoarthritis. METHODS: A scoping review of the available scientific literature for hip biologics was performed, with available evidence for hyaluronic acid (HA), platelet rich plasma (PRP), stem/stromal cells, microfracture, mosaicplasty, osteochondral allograft, and cell-based therapies investigated. RESULTS: To date, there exist better guidelines and further consensus concerning knee joint biologic treatments than the hip due to a greater number of studies as well as the more recent emergence of hip preservation approaches. However, increasing evidence is available for the selective implementation of biologics on an individualized basis with attention to lesion size and location. CONCLUSION: Orthopedic surgeons are at an exciting crossroads in medicine, where hip biologic therapies are evolving and increasingly available. Timetested interventions such as arthroplasty have shown good results and still have a major role to play but newer, regenerative approaches have the potential to effectively delay or reduce the requirement for such invasive procedures.

AIM: The aim of the study was to compare the healing and osseous regeneration of mandibular third molar extraction sockets with and without platelet-rich plasma (PRP) with the evaluation of clinical objectives such as pain, swelling, trismus, soft tissue healing, pocket depth distal to second molar and radiological evaluation of the bony density in the postextracted third molar socket. MATERIALS AND METHODS: In this prospective study, 100 patients were selected by the random sampling method from the outpatient department of oral and maxillofacial surgery in the year 2016-2017. Patients were equally allocated into intervention (transalveolar extraction followed by PRP placement) and nonintervention (transalveolar extraction without PRP placement) group as group I and group II, respectively, and evaluation parameters were considered accordingly. The statistical analysis was done using SPSS (Statistical Package for Social Sciences) Version 15.0 (IBM, USA) statistical analysis software. RESULTS: The pain score of patients of group I (non-PRP) was found to be higher as compared to group II (with PRP). Mean trismus of patients of group II was found to be higher than that of group I at postoperative day 7, but this difference was not found to be statistically significant. Swelling at T-Sn (Tragus-Subnasale) and T-Pog (Tragus-Pogonion) was higher among patients of group I as compared to group II. Healing in group II was two to three times faster than group I. Healing among patients of group I and group II was found to be statistically significant. The mean pocket depth of patients of group I was found to be significantly higher than that of group II at follow-up of 1 and 2 months. The bone density of patients of group II was found to be significantly higher than that of group I at 3 months and 6 months follow-up. CONCLUSION: The procedure of PRP preparation is simple and cost-effective, and can be prepared at the point of care. It had a significant impact on the postoperative healing of the third molar socket. CLINICAL SIGNIFICANCE: The use of PRP application increases the bone density, healing process, and improvement in the pain and swelling, and there was a definite reduction in trismus and periodontal probing depth after the impacted mandibular wisdom teeth extraction.

BACKGROUND: Iodine deficiency is one of the most prevalent micronutrient deficiencies globally. Women in reproductive age group are vulnerable to develop iodine deficiency as there is an increase in demand for iodine, especially during pregnancy. OBJECTIVES: The objective is to assess the prevalence of goiter and its association with iodine status and salt usage practices among the women of reproductive age group. METHODS: A community-based cross-sectional study was conducted from August 2015 to July 2017 among 1500 women of reproductive age group in five villages of Udupi Taluk. Stratified sampling design and proportion to population size of the reproductive age women in the study area was used to select the study participants. A pretested semi-structured questionnaire was used for data collection. Goiter was assessed clinically and graded as per the recommended criteria of the WHO. Salt samples from every household were collected for iodine estimation. Blood and urine samples were collected from subsample to estimate thyroid-stimulating hormone levels and urinary iodine excretion levels, respectively. RESULTS: The overall prevalence of goiter was 13% with 11.5% being Grade 1 and 1.5% being Grade 2. No significant association of goiter with urinary iodine, salt iodine levels, and salt usage practices was found. CONCLUSIONS: Median urinary iodine among the women with goiter indicates iodine sufficiency and no significant difference observed in urinary iodine levels between women with and without goiter.

STUDY OBJECTIVE: Fifty percent of laparoscopic bowel and vascular injuries occur at the time of entry. These serious complications can lead to significant morbidity and even mortality. This video demonstrates 3 techniques that have been developed to minimize the risk of these injuries during entry. DESIGN: Step-by-step description of 3 techniques that can be used as a highly reliable and safe method of obtaining intraperitoneal entry during laparoscopy. MEASUREMENTS AND MAIN RESULTS: Caudal displacement of the umbilicus before insertion of the veress needle allows for a median displacement of 6 cm between the site of entry and the common iliac vessels. An entry pressure of less than 9 mm Hg is suggestive of successful intraperitoneal entry. The left upper quadrant should be used in specific cases instead of the umbilicus as the point of entry for the veress needle. The use of a visualized trocarless cannula instead of a conventional primary trocar for entry after insufflation allows for real-time recognition of injury and converts linear penetrating force to radial torque. CONCLUSION: These 3 techniques can help decrease the risk and improve intraoperative recognition of serious bowel and vascular injuries during laparoscopy.

Uncovering the genetic factors that correlate with a clinical deviation of previously unknown etiology helps to diminish the unknown variation influencing the phenotype. Clinical studies, particularly those that consider the effects of an appliance or treatment regimen on growth, need to be a part of these types of genetic investigations in the future. While the day-to-day utilization of "testing" for genetic factors is not ready for practice yet, genetic testing for monogenic traits such as Primary Failure of Eruption (PFE) and Class III malocclusion is showing more promise as knowledge and technology advances. Although the heterogeneous complexity of such things as facial and dental development, the physiology of tooth movement, and the occurrence of External Apical Root Resorption (EARR) make their precise prediction untenable, investigations into the genetic factors that influence different phenotypes, and how these factors may relate to or impact environmental factors (including orthodontic treatment) are becoming better understood. The most important "genetic test" the practitioner can do today is to gather the patient's individual and family history. This would greatly benefit the patient, and augment the usefulness of these families in future clinical research in which clinical findings, environmental, and genetic factors can be studied.

In this work, we report the role of ice-like water adlayers (IWLs) formed under ambient conditions in between mechanically exfoliated as-prepared and patterned few layer graphene (FLG) and multi-layer graphene (MLG) on hydrophobic Si and hydrophilic SiO2/Si substrates. The growth of the IWL is probed by measuring the height changes in graphene using intermittent contact atomic force microscopy (IC-AFM) and their electrostatic effect is studied using electrostatic force microscopy (EFM) over time. It is found that more IWLs are formed within a shorter period of time, when both as-prepared graphene and underlying substrates are either hydrophobic or hydrophilic in nature. In contrast, AFM voltage nanolithographically patterned trenches on FLG and MLG on the Si substrate show quick formation of IWLs. The effect of IWL formed, on the dimensions of trenches, is correlated with the variation of the measured EFM phase shift over time. This study demonstrates the dependence of the formation of IWLs under ambient conditions on the affinity towards water, at the interface of graphene on hydrophobic and hydrophilic substrates, which has important implications for the performance of graphene-based nanoelectronic devices.

The value of testing for inherited thrombophilia in pregnancy has been debated in literature with regard to its utility in preventing adverse obstetrical outcomes or identifying women at risk for it. In this commentary, an evidence based approach is used to investigate the strength of association between thrombophilias and recurrent pregnancy loss and stillbirth. Several studies and meta-analyses have shown that there is only a weak association with recurrent pregnancy loss. However, many of these studies were underpowered, and there was significant heterogeneity-issues that are addressed in this paper. The evidence for association with stillbirth is lacking, but the few studies that are available seem to suggest a stronger correlation than for recurrent pregnancy loss. Further, the benefit of treating thrombophilias with anticoagulation in order to prevent these outcomes is discussed. While there is a lack of evidence looking at whether anticoagulation prevents stillbirth, there is strong evidence to show that anticoagulation does not prevent recurrent pregnancy loss. Finally, guidelines put out by various obstetrical and hematological societies regarding this topic are summarized.

Stress fractures, a common overuse injury in physically active individuals, present a significant challenge for athletes and military personnel. Patients who sustain stress fractures have demanding training regimes where periods of rest and immobilisation have unacceptable negative consequences on sports goals and finances. Aside from being an overuse injury, there are various contributing risk factors that put certain individuals at risk of a stress fracture. The main two being nutritional deficiencies and hormonal variations, which have significant effects on bone metabolism and turnover. Historically, treatment of stress fractures focused on conservative strategies such as rest and immobilisation. Calcium and vitamin D deficiencies have been closely linked to stress fractures and so over time supplementation has also played a role in treatment. With the introduction of biologics into orthopaedics, newer treatment strategies have been applied to accelerate fracture healing and perhaps improve fracture callus quality. If such therapies can reduce time spent away from sport and activity, it would be ideal for treating stress fractures. This article aims to offer insights into the evolving landscape of stress fracture management. It investigates the pre-clinical evidence and available published clinical applications. Though fracture healing is well understood, the role of biologics for fracture healing is still indeterminate. Available literature for the use of biologic therapies in stress fractures are restricted and most reports have used biologics as a supplement to surgical fixation in subjects in studies that lack control groups. Randomised control trials have been proposed and registered by a few groups, with results awaited. Assessing individuals for risk factors, addressing hormonal imbalances and nutritional deficiencies seems like an effective approach to addressing the burden of stress fractures. We await better designed trials and studies to accurately determine the clinical benefit of adding biologics to the management of these injuries.

BACKGROUND: Tooth extraction is one of the most commonly performed procedures in dentistry. It is usually a traumatic procedure often resulting in immediate destruction and loss of alveolar bone and surrounding soft tissues. It is the only dental procedure which was carried out by dentists in the previous centuries and various instruments have evolved for this procedure over time. Atraumatic extraction is one of the essential dental procedures, as atraumatic extraction leads to proper wound healing and appropriate bone healing. Physics forceps have got a new role in extraction technique, that it makes just one contact point with the tooth as a unique benefit. Physics forceps depends on the physics of rotational power, lever and torque much like a bottle top removal. A study was conducted to evaluate the efficacy of physics forceps and conventional forces in the extraction of maxillary molar. METHODS: Eligible participants were adults aged 18-50 diagnosed with grossly decayed maxillary molars with poor endodontic prognosis and willing to participate in the study. Exclusion criteria were as follows: patients with dilacerate roots; patients with systemic diseases like hypertension, diabetes mellitus, thyroid, tuberculosis, epilepsy seizures, COVID-19 positive; patients' non-acceptance to voluntarily participate in research a refusal to sign the informed consent. Parameters such as a crown fracture or root fracture; buccal bone fracture; time taken for extraction and operator ease on the VAS scale are assessed. RESULTS: Results showed that with the use of physics forces, there was very less incidence of crown fracture and no incidence of buccal bone fracture, whereas with the conventional forceps the result showed that in almost all the time taken for extraction was much more in conventional forcep and the operator ease rating was more with conventional forceps. CONCLUSIONS: Hence, oral surgeons as well as general practitioner should adapt the use of physics forceps in routine extractions.

Background: Inappropriate feces disposal leads to environmental contamination, and increases the risk of exposure to children. We aimed to estimate the proportion of rural households with knowledge and practice of safe management of feces (SMoF) among under-five children and to identify associated factors. Materials and Methods: A cross-sectional study was conducted in eight villages in Bengaluru Urban district over 2 months, using a face-validated semi-structured interview schedule. SMoF was defined based on five criteria - defecation site, transport tool, feces disposal, cleaning of transport tool, and hand washing. Results: Out of 320 under-five children surveyed, 15.7% were pre-ambulatory and 84.3% were ambulatory. The majority of the caregivers (92.5%) felt that children should defecate in the latrine and only 23.7% were aware that child feces were more infectious than adult feces. SMoF was only practiced by caregivers of ambulatory children (52.6%). Households with older caregivers (P = 0.01) and those living in a pucca house (P = 0.02) with a latrine inside (P = 0.04) were found to practice SMoF. Children of households that practiced unsafe disposal of child feces experienced more diarrheal episodes (P = 0.04). Caregivers >20 years were found to have better odds of SMoF [20-25 years (adjusted odds ratio, aOR: 9.02), 26-30 years (aOR: 12.17), >30 years (aOR: 8.93)] compared to those <20 years. Conclusion: The proportion of households with knowledge and practice of SMoF was low. Awareness of SMoF is essential to reduce the incidence of diarrheal diseases and improve sanitation. Our findings also call for awareness building at schools and colleges.

OBJECTIVE: This study was undertaken to identify variations in the hip joint space in patients with healed Legg-Calvé-Perthes' disease (LCPD) and to correlate these changes with the radiological outcome of treatment. METHODS: The width of the joint space was measured on radiographs of 121 skeletally mature individuals with healed LCPD. The joint space width at the stage of healing in 79 patients was compared with the joint space at skeletal maturity. The hips were graded by the Stulberg classification and the femoral head radius was measured. Associations between the joint space width, the Stulberg class and the femoral head radius were tested. The reproducibility of measurement was tested by measuring 30 radiographs twice and computing the intra-class correlation coefficient (ICC). The joint space width was measured on radiographs of 25 patients taken both while recumbent and standing, to determine if the joint space alters on weight-bearing. RESULTS: The reproducibility of measurements was satisfactory; no difference was noted in the joint space in recumbent and weight-bearing films. Increased joint space was noted both at healing of the disease and at skeletal maturity; the width was minimally increased in Stulberg Class I hips and considerably increased in Class III, IV and V hips. There was a significant correlation between the increase in joint space and enlargement of the femoral head. CONCLUSIONS: An increase in joint space width occurs quite frequently following LCPD; the increase is most evident in hips with a poor outcome. The implications of this observation need to be elucidated.

Introduction: Patients with Paget's disease develop abnormal bony anatomy which can result in significantly altered lower limb alignment predisposing them to early secondary osteoarthritis. Due to the severe extra-articular deformity, total knee arthroplasty (TKA) in these patients is challenging. Conventional knee arthroplasty using intramedullary guides is not an option and can lead to erroneous limb alignment postoperatively. Patient-specific instrumentation (PSI) is a simple solution in such complex primary knee arthroplasty. Case Report: A 70-year-old male patient presented with a severe left femur deformity and left knee pain. He was diagnosed to have monostotic Paget's disease of the left femur with tricompartmental osteoarthritis of the left knee. After reduction in pathological bone turnover, the patient was planned for a total knee replacement. As a standard intramedullary femoral jig was not applicable due to the femoral deformity, a computed topography-based 3D-printed patient-specific instrument was used. This custom jig was used to define and perform the distal femur cut at 90 degrees to the mechanical axis of the femur in the coronal and sagittal plane. Postoperatively, the patient did well and achieved good function and pain relief. Conclusion: The use of a 3D-printed PSI for complex primary knee arthroplasty is an excellent option with no additional operative time than a conventional knee arthroplasty. Although a robotic or computer-navigated TKA would be an excellent option in this case, we restored the limb alignment using a cost-effective patient-specific femoral jig. This could be a viable option in centers without navigation or robotic arthroplasty.
